CVE-2018-7175: An issue was discovered in xpdf 4.00.

An issue was discovered in xpdf 4.00. A NULL pointer dereference in readCodestream allows an attacker to cause denial of service via a JPX image with zero components.

Plain-English summary

CVE-2018-7175 is a denial-of-service flaw in xpdf 4.00. A specially malformed JPX image can make the PDF parser crash because it dereferences a NULL pointer. The public record does not show data theft, code execution, or confirmed active exploitation.

Executive priority

Treat this as operational stability risk, not a confirmed breach risk. Prioritize if xpdf 4.00 processes customer-uploaded or email-delivered documents at scale; otherwise handle through normal dependency remediation.

Technical view

The issue is a NULL pointer dereference in xpdf 4.00 within readCodestream when handling a JPX image with zero components. The documented impact is application denial of service. The source bundle does not provide CVSS, CWE, complete affected CPE data, or named fixed versions.

Likely exposure

Exposure is most likely where xpdf 4.00 or software embedding its parser processes untrusted PDFs or JPX image content, especially in automated document pipelines. The bundle does not identify downstream products or package names.

Exploitation context

A malicious document can trigger a crash when parsed by the affected xpdf code path. No cited source or KEV listing supports active exploitation in the wild, and the bundle does not describe public exploit availability.

Mitigation direction

  • Inventory systems and applications using xpdf 4.00.
  • Check current Xpdf vendor guidance for fixed versions or patches.
  • Reduce automated processing of untrusted PDFs where xpdf 4.00 is present.
  • Run document parsing services with crash isolation and restart controls.
  • Prioritize remediation for internet-facing upload or conversion workflows.

Validation and detection

  • Search SBOMs, packages, containers, and build files for xpdf 4.00.
  • Identify services that parse user-supplied PDFs or JPX content.
  • Review crash logs for xpdf failures during document processing.
  • Confirm vendor advisory status before claiming a fixed version.
  • Verify compensating controls around document ingestion workflows.
